"Disco Elysium remains one of the most written-through RPGs ever made, a noir where every thought becomes a character. The Final Cut adds full voice acting, and hearing these voices gnaw at a drunken detective changes everything. Dense, funny, sometimes devastating."

"An absolute masterpiece, the first fully 3D Final Fantasy on a Sony console. The CTB combat system, the moving story of Tidus and Yuna, and the art direction of Spira compose a transcendent experience. One of the greatest achievements in role-playing game history."

"Vagrant Story is an absolute Square and Yasumi Matsuno masterpiece. Ashley Riot in the catacombs of Leá Monde in an action dungeon RPG adventure with an extraordinarily deep weapon customization system. Masterful political narrative, breathtaking PS1 visuals. An unsurpassable creative pinnacle of video gaming."

"Enriched Japanese version of FFX with the bonus Dark Aeons, Penance, Expert and Black Sphere Grids and additional scenes. The most complete JRPG experience on PS2 with content for hundreds of hours. The definitive version for fans wanting to exhaust the title."
